Facebook believes so strongly in an alternative virtual world that it is planning to spend US$10bil (RM42bil) this year developing its own metaverse, where people can socialise, work and play.

At this point, there is no way of telling which companies will dominate. Facebook has made its intentions clear, but Apple and Google are yet to explain what their vision of a metaverse could look like.

Yiu highlights Nvidia as a potential winner in this respect. This company, listed on the Nasdaq market in the United States, produces the GPU — a graphics card — which is commonly used in gaming and dominates its market. Yiu adds: 'If the metaverse is going to come, it will need a lot of Nvidia's cards. It would be a clear winner, irrespective of whether the metaverse is developed by Facebook, Google or Amazon.

For example, investment fund iShares S&P 500 Information Technology Sector holds the likes of Apple, Nvidia, Micron and Microsoft in its portfolio. Annual charges total 0.15% and shares in the fund can be bought via major investment platform providers such as Hargreaves Lansdown.
